Understanding What a Gold IRA Is

A Gold IRA, or Individual Retirement Account, is a self-directed retirement account that allows investors to hold physical gold and other precious metals as part of their retirement savings. Unlike traditional IRAs, which typically include stocks, bonds, and mutual funds, a Gold IRA provides a unique opportunity to diversify your investment portfolio with tangible assets.

This type of account is appealing to those who are concerned about economic instability and wish to hedge against inflation. As gold often retains its value over time, it becomes a reliable option for securing long-term financial goals. Setting up a Gold IRA can seem daunting at first, but with the right guidance, it becomes a straightforward process.

Choosing the Right Custodian

One of the first steps in setting up a Gold IRA is choosing a reputable custodian. Custodians are financial institutions that manage your account and ensure compliance with IRS regulations. When selecting a custodian, consider their experience, fees, and customer service. Researching and comparing different custodians will help you find one that aligns with your investment goals.

It’s crucial to confirm that your chosen custodian is approved by the IRS to handle precious metal IRAs. This ensures your investments are stored securely and in accordance with legal requirements. A trustworthy custodian will also provide guidance on purchasing and storing gold within your IRA.

Deciding on the Type of Gold

Once you have chosen a custodian, the next step is to decide on the type of gold you want to include in your IRA. The IRS has specific guidelines about the forms of gold that are eligible. Typically, gold must be in the form of coins or bars and meet purity standards.

Some popular options include American Gold Eagle coins, Canadian Gold Maple Leaf coins, and gold bars from accredited refiners. It’s important to work closely with your custodian to ensure that the gold you purchase meets all necessary criteria.

Purchasing and Storing Your Gold

After deciding on the type of gold, you can proceed with purchasing it through your custodian. They will help facilitate the transaction to ensure all processes adhere to IRS guidelines. It's essential to use a trusted dealer that your custodian recommends or approves.

Once purchased, your gold will be stored in a secure depository. Unlike traditional investments, you cannot store your gold at home; it must be held in an approved facility. The custodian will provide information about storage options and associated fees.

Understanding the Fees Involved

Setting up and maintaining a Gold IRA involves various fees that investors should be aware of. These fees typically include account setup fees, annual maintenance fees, storage fees, and sometimes a seller’s fee when purchasing gold.

It is important to understand each fee structure before committing to any particular custodian or dealer. Comparing costs between different providers will help ensure you are getting the best value for your investment.
